The digitalisation of financial services has transformed how issuers distribute products, removing friction from the process and lowering costs. Online platforms offer brokers a level of access to retail investors, which would have been hard to imagine 20 years ago.
Distributing structured products is more complex than a conventional investment like equity due to the way the payoff works and greater regulatory scrutiny. The value of equity either rises or falls (and, in some cases, it pays a dividend). In contrast, the payoff generated by a structured product may depend on an event, such as the breach of an upside or downside barrier, which results in nonlinear exposure to the underlying asset.
To date, distributing structured products has been largely manual, involving the exchange of a high volume of emails and telephone calls between the issuer and the manufacturer of the derivative, providing exposure to the underlying asset.
